Reply: (edit)Search a different thread on a different site...its pretty much useless trying to copy an xbox game from your computer unless you have a modded xbox. The computer's dvd drive can't read an xbox game! If you try to burn it it will just copy an audio/video file amounting to like 13 megs. The only way that I've read about is by transferring files from your modded xbox to your computer and then burning them. And to bungholio...you CAN burn xbox games!!!
